I'm not aware of any sensors in the seats to manage airbags, so if the airbag lamp is on, then I would suspect there is something more drastic going on. The fault codes are pullable as described in the link.
Siezed calipers is a common issue on most older Lexus models. They will come and go, and generally be a bit of a pain unless you overhaul the calipers and slide pins. A company called BigRed do the calipers ata very decent price, I think my two rears including slide pins cost £50 for the pair when I got them (a few years ago mind you).

Aircon will need recharging if it isn't blowing cold, but until it is recharged, you won't know if there are any major leaks (generally it will only need to be redone if it leaked out - unless someone inadvertantly let it out of course which would be unlikely).
The OD light flashing does indicate a fault, not sure of vibrations causing a fault to register, but I guess that is possible if the mounts are that far gone.
